Spotlight on: Takayuki Ueda

I'm Taka Ueda from Osaka Japan, falling in love with the NZIF because of everybody's heart warming support to let me advance on the way to the next stage in international improv scene. I'm an improviser and an artistic director of IMPACT360 in Osaka Japan. It's the third time that I have took part in NZIF. Once in two years, 2015, 2017 and 2019.

Spotlight On: Christine Brooks

Christine Brooks has been improvising for over 20 years. She has directed, taught and performed at improv festivals around the world including in Germany, Sweden, Ireland, France, UK, Australia and of course New Zealand. She is a founding member of the New Zealand Improvisation Trust and a former Artistic Director of the New Zealand Improv Festival.

Spotlight On: Jennifer O'Sullivan

Jennifer O'Sullivan is a performer and producer in Wellington, NZ, with a long history of making things up as she goes along. As an improv teacher she has travelled nationally and internationally, helping improvisors become fearless and work naturally on stage. She is currently completing an MFA in Creative Practice at Victoria University, and has served as the festival director for New Zealand Improv Festival since 2014.

Spotlight On: Clare Kerrison

Clare Kerrison is an experienced improv teacher, performer and arts administrator. Since returning to Wellington in 2016, she has become the improv teacher for Basejump Improv, performed with Wellington Soap Factory (Lyall Baywatch, Deep Space Naenae) developed her solo show (Clare Kerrison's Infernal Recall) and created a plus-one act (Meet Cute).
